Output 5838d89404c41f62c4a2fcce7cdf26bed130a168b30637ce4043f3c4dd0a34fd:0

value
17978471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d79e1f26030653c094c374ee7435bc85d4e83267 OP_EQUAL
address
3MM6dGqHzxmXSvfaAFgQTAcXMkkH5F3VrX
transaction
5838d89404c41f62c4a2fcce7cdf26bed130a168b30637ce4043f3c4dd0a34fd
spent
true